[20.11,05/19] doc: remove references to make in bbdev guides
Checks
Commit Message
Make is no longer supported for compiling DPDK, references are now
removed in the documentation.

@@ -12,14 +12,6 @@ Note that the driver can also be built without any dependency with reduced
functionality for maintenance purpose.
To enable linking to the SDK libraries see detailed installation section below.
-Two flags can be enabled depending on whether the target machine can support
-AVX2 and AVX512 instructions sets and the related SDK libraries for vectorized
-signal processing functions are installed :
-- CONFIG_RTE_BBDEV_SDK_AVX2
-- CONFIG_RTE_BBDEV_SDK_AVX512
-By default these 2 flags are disabled by default. For AVX2 machine and SDK
-library installed then the first flag can be enabled. For AVX512 machine and
-SDK library installed then both flags can be enabled for full real time capability.
This PMD supports the functions: FEC, Rate Matching and CRC functions detailed
in the Features section.
